Output 65c7894146eaedf02221fa664c2793e36ca90ac9309f6eab87c11bf33b60f94e:1

value
55955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4453f00b964d260547aa52c4a05600b1a2912b13 OP_EQUAL
address
37vJRgQcdzpcTGhpzKqpQSzXhqGcjbaqiu
transaction
65c7894146eaedf02221fa664c2793e36ca90ac9309f6eab87c11bf33b60f94e
confirmations
283974
spent
true